  3. Q

    7-Element Yagi Range Extender 2.4 Ghz for MM (CE)

    The additonal gain due to multireflectors is in my opinion quite low. More effective is a streched design like my long version of the 7-element yagi. This brings up to 2 dBi on top. ?

    7-Element Yagi Range Extender 2.4 Ghz for MM (CE)

    Aluminium or copper doesn´t make a big difference. Copper is a little bit better but only if its not oxidized, which goes fast in a few weeks. Steel is much worse and for this purpose not a good choice. Better would be silver but I guess nobody would like to pay for that ;) Pipes would be no...
